Published October 6, 2021 | Version v1.0
Software Open

Ngesh: a Python library for synthetic phylogenetic data

  • 1. Uppsala universitet

Description

This archives includes version 1.0 of `ngesh` (https://pypi.org/project/ngesh/), a Python library for simulating phylogenetic trees and data, designed for usage in development, debugging, and benchmarking of analysis pipelines and methods for phylogenetic inference, particularly in historical linguistics and stemmatics. The package generates reproducible stochastic simulations of evolution according to various criteria, including character mutation rates and probability of horizontal transfer, and its results can include the simulation of inadequate data compilation and sampling. Different output formats are supported, both for visualization (such as plain text and with integrated graphical viewers) and for software interoperability (such as Newick and NEXUS).

Note that this release includes all the files for version 1.0 of ngesh, as it will appear in a published article. The article will be linked from the main repository ( https.//github.com/tresoldi/ngesh )as soon as published.

Full Changelog: https://github.com/tresoldi/ngesh/compare/v0.1.2...v1.0

Files

tresoldi/ngesh-v1.0.zip

Files (1.8 MB)

Name Size Download all
md5:b9f48c40d9f691e92fcc497baecba554
1.8 MB Preview Download

Additional details

Related works